Readings In Later Chinese Philosophy by Justin Tiwald, Bryan W. Van Norden
Han to the 20th Century
This comprehensive anthology offers a deep dive into the rich tapestry of Chinese philosophical thought from the Song dynasty to the early 20th century. It presents a curated selection of texts that explore the evolution of Confucianism, Daoism, and Buddhism, highlighting the dynamic interplay between these traditions and their responses to social, political, and ethical challenges. The collection is meticulously organized to provide readers with both historical context and philosophical analysis, making it an invaluable resource for understanding the complexities and enduring relevance of later Chinese philosophy.
